Output bc54db858a1c0596b8c247d27cd2963578a5f18b304772190204ac73fe69c103:19

value
170000000
script pubkey
OP_0 OP_PUSHBYTES_20 ca88f2ab3f609273e1c13dcf00c5fcfc45461cc2
address
bc1qe2y092elvzf88cwp8h8sp30ul3z5v8xzvajuzq
transaction
bc54db858a1c0596b8c247d27cd2963578a5f18b304772190204ac73fe69c103
spent
true